Choosing AI Providers & Potential Evaluation
Selecting the right artificial intelligence vendor is a critical undertaking, demanding far more than just a quick product demo. A robust potential analysis process must be included from the outset. This involves meticulously examining the vendor’s engineering capabilities, including their data protection protocols, model interpretability, and adherence to relevant ethical guidelines. Moreover, consider their financial standing, their promise to ongoing support and upkeep, and their ability to scale their solutions to meet anticipated needs. Failing to conduct a thorough assessment could expose your business to significant financial threats. Consider, too, the compliance landscape and how the vendor’s practices align with governing laws.
AI Governance & Procurement
Successfully adopting artificial intelligence solutions demands more than just a robust approach; it necessitates a meticulous focus on AI oversight & acquisition best procedures. Organizations must define clear responsible guidelines and regulatory frameworks *before* committing into procurement deals. A proactive strategy should feature thorough due evaluation of vendor expertise, with a particular emphasis on their own AI governance and data protection systems. Furthermore, a centralized acquisition process, including a dedicated moral AI review board, can help mitigate potential hazards and ensure trustworthy AI usage. Ignoring these vital elements can lead to considerable reputational, economic, and regulatory repercussions.
